Introduction to Fish Poisoning

Fish poisoning can be caused by various factors, including the consumption of fish and shellfish that contain toxins, such as mercury, ciguatoxins, and saxitoxins. These toxins can be found in fish and shellfish from polluted waters or those that have ingested toxic algae. The most common types of fish poisoning are ciguatera fish poisoning, scombroid fish poisoning, and shellfish poisoning. Ciguatera fish poisoning is caused by the consumption of fish that contain ciguatoxins, which are produced by certain types of algae. Scombroid fish poisoning occurs when fish, such as tuna and mackerel, are not stored properly, allowing bacteria to grow and produce histamine. Shellfish poisoning, on the other hand, is caused by the consumption of shellfish that contain toxins, such as saxitoxins and domoic acid.

Symptoms of Fish Poisoning

The symptoms of fish poisoning can vary depending on the type and amount of toxin consumed. Common symptoms include nausea, vomiting, diarrhea, abdominal pain, and headache. In severe cases, fish poisoning can cause neurological symptoms, such as numbness, tingling, and muscle weakness. Ciguatera fish poisoning, for example, can cause symptoms such as paralysis, respiratory failure, and cardiac arrest. Scombroid fish poisoning can cause symptoms such as hives, itching, and difficulty breathing. Shellfish poisoning can cause symptoms such as confusion, disorientation, and memory loss.

Acute and Chronic Symptoms

Fish poisoning can cause both acute and chronic symptoms. Acute symptoms occur shortly after consumption and can last for several hours or days. Chronic symptoms, on the other hand, can persist for weeks, months, or even years after the initial exposure. Chronic symptoms can include fatigue, joint pain, and neurological problems, such as memory loss and cognitive impairment. Causes of Fish Poisoning

Fish poisoning can be caused by various factors, including the consumption of contaminated or toxic fish and shellfish. The most common causes of fish poisoning are:

  • Polluted waters: Fish and shellfish from polluted waters can contain toxins, such as mercury and pesticides.
  • Toxic algae: Certain types of algae can produce toxins, such as ciguatoxins and saxitoxins, which can be ingested by fish and shellfish.
  • Improper storage: Fish and shellfish that are not stored properly can allow bacteria to grow and produce toxins, such as histamine.
  • Cross-contamination: Fish and shellfish can become contaminated with toxins during processing, handling, or storage.
  • Climate change: Climate change can cause an increase in the growth of toxic algae, which can lead to an increase in fish poisoning.

Safe Handling and Storage

Safe handling and storage are crucial to preventing fish poisoning. Always handle fish and shellfish gently, and avoid cross-contamination with other foods. Store fish and shellfish in a covered container and keep them refrigerated at a temperature below 40°F (4°C). Cook fish and shellfish to the recommended internal temperature to kill any bacteria or viruses that may be present.

What are the causes of fish poisoning?

There are several causes of fish poisoning, including contamination with bacteria, viruses, parasites, and toxins. Bacterial contamination can occur when fish are caught in polluted waters or handled improperly. Viral contamination can occur when fish are infected with viruses such as norovirus or hepatitis A. Parasitic contamination can occur when fish are infected with parasites such as Anisakis or Pseudoterranova. Toxins, such as mercury or ciguatoxins, can also accumulate in fish and cause poisoning. These toxins can be produced by certain types of algae or can be present in the environment due to pollution.
